Unison is a global telecom and renewables infrastructure
investment firm founded in 2003. We today own 2,200 sites and
facilities hosting mission-critical wireless and telecom
transmission assets and renewable power generation projects. We own
real property or real property interests in the United States and
Italy, Spain, France, Germany and Poland. Our capital is provided
primarily by Ardian (a $200 billion AUM Paris-based asset manager).
We are growing rapidly and seeking key members of our team. The
Job: The Treasurer will be responsible for overseeing the company’s
global treasury function, including cash management, liquidity
forecasting, capital markets transactions, banking infrastructure,
and financial risk management. This role will play a critical part
in supporting debt recapitalization, private placement initiatives,
cross?border liquidity, and capital deployment for acquisitions and
growth initiatives. The ideal candidate will bring deep experience
in multinational treasury operations and the sophistication to
manage a complex, evolving capital structure. Global Treasury &
Liquidity Management Lead daily global cash positioning, short? and
long?term liquidity forecasting, and multi?currency cash
management. Develop and maintain global cash structures, including
pooling, sweeping, and intercompany liquidity frameworks. Oversight
of FX exposure, hedging programs, and multi?jurisdictional
liquidity needs. Capital Markets & Debt Portfolio Management
Oversee a multi?currency debt portfolio across U.S. and European
lenders. Lead recapitalization, refinancing, private placements,
and capital markets planning. Manage covenants, reporting, lender
communications, and financing strategy. Risk Management &
Compliance Establish policies for interest rate, FX, liquidity, and
counterparty risk. Ensure adherence to internal controls, treasury
governance, and global regulatory requirements. Oversee treasury
audit readiness and compliance tracking. Banking & Stakeholder
Relationship Management Build, optimize, and manage global banking
relationships across multiple jurisdictions. Negotiate bank fees,
credit terms, hedging facilities, and treasury service agreements.
Serve as treasury liaison to lenders, advisors, and investors.
Reporting, Analytics & Strategic Support Prepare KPIs, liquidity
dashboards, and debt analytics for senior leadership and the Board.
Conduct scenario modeling, stress testing, and capital markets
analysis. Collaborate with FP&A and corporate development on
forecasting, acquisitions, and expansion Requirements: Education &
